Abstract

The development of organic food market constitutes an element of a far more complex phenomenon of ecological consumption and reinforcement of a new paradigm called green marketing.


Sustainable development strategies in the agri-food industry vary widely, ranging from mainstream agriculture becoming more ecological through the development of local production and consumption networks, organic farming to fair trade. We observe a dynamic growth in the value of organic food market in developed economies. From 2004 to 2012, the size of the European organic food market doubled. Further development of organic food market depends, inter alia, on the structure of distribution channels and pricing level, long-term trends in the national income growth and the development of ecological awareness of the society.
